Exploration d'architectures d'accélérateurs approximatives à l'aide de cadres automatisés sur des FPGA

Nœud source: 2009561

L’utilisation de réseaux de portes programmables sur site (FPGA) pour le développement d’architectures d’accélérateurs approximatives est devenue de plus en plus populaire ces dernières années. Cela est dû à leur capacité à fournir des solutions hautes performances, faible consommation et faible coût pour une variété d’applications. Des frameworks automatisés ont été développés pour aider à explorer des architectures d'accélérateurs approximatives sur les FPGA, permettant ainsi aux développeurs de créer et d'optimiser plus facilement leurs conceptions.

L'un des frameworks automatisés les plus populaires pour explorer les architectures d'accélérateurs approximatives sur les FPGA est l'approximate Computing Framework (ACF). Ce framework fournit un ensemble d'outils et de bibliothèques qui permettent aux développeurs d'explorer rapidement et facilement différentes techniques de calcul approximatif sur les FPGA. ACF fournit également une bibliothèque de fonctions de calcul approximatives prédéfinies, qui peuvent être utilisées pour créer rapidement des architectures d'accélérateurs approximatives.

Un autre cadre automatisé populaire pour explorer les architectures d'accélérateurs approximatives sur les FPGA est l'approximate Computing Library (ACL). Cette bibliothèque fournit un ensemble d'outils et de bibliothèques qui permettent aux développeurs d'explorer rapidement et facilement différentes techniques de calcul approximatif sur les FPGA. ACL fournit également une bibliothèque de fonctions de calcul approximatives prédéfinies, qui peuvent être utilisées pour créer rapidement des architectures d'accélérateurs approximatives.

L'approximate Computing Toolkit (ACT) est un autre cadre automatisé permettant d'explorer les architectures d'accélérateurs approximatives sur les FPGA. Cette boîte à outils fournit un ensemble d'outils et de bibliothèques qui permettent aux développeurs d'explorer rapidement et facilement différentes techniques de calcul approximatif sur les FPGA. ACT fournit également une bibliothèque de fonctions de calcul approximatives prédéfinies, qui peuvent être utilisées pour créer rapidement des architectures d'accélérateurs approximatives.

Enfin, l'Environnement informatique approximatif (ACE) est un cadre automatisé permettant d'explorer les architectures d'accélérateurs approximatives sur les FPGA. Cet environnement fournit un ensemble d'outils et de bibliothèques qui permettent aux développeurs d'explorer rapidement et facilement différentes techniques de calcul approximatif sur les FPGA. ACE fournit également une bibliothèque de fonctions de calcul approximatives prédéfinies, qui peuvent être utilisées pour créer rapidement des architectures d'accélérateurs approximatives.

Dans l’ensemble, les frameworks automatisés tels qu’ACF, ACL, ACT et ACE ont permis aux développeurs d’explorer plus facilement les architectures d’accélérateurs approximatives sur les FPGA. Ces frameworks fournissent un ensemble d'outils et de bibliothèques qui permettent aux développeurs d'explorer rapidement et facilement différentes techniques de calcul approximatif sur les FPGA. De plus, ces frameworks fournissent une bibliothèque de fonctions de calcul approximatives prédéfinies, qui peuvent être utilisées pour créer rapidement des architectures d'accélérateurs approximatives. En tant que tels, ces cadres automatisés sont devenus de plus en plus populaires ces dernières années et devraient continuer à être utilisés à l'avenir.

Horodatage:

Plus de Semi-conducteur / Web3